Controlling the Game: Dabuz talks GameCube controller modding, art, and button layout
Super Smash Bros News In our first installment of Controlling the Game, Ultimate pro Dabuz shares what makes his GameCube controllers unique to him. It’s been over 20 years since Super Smash Bros. Melee came out on the GameCube but the Smash community has continued to use GameCube controllers to play Melee, Brawl, Smash 4, and Ultimate. But not every GameCube controller is the same. Pro players bring their own GameCube controllers to tournaments because their controllers are unique to them — they are decorated a certain way, customized differently, and broken in a certain way based on the pro’s playstyle....
